This specification covers an aluminum alloy in the form of bars, rods, and wire. These product have been used typically for parts requiring high strength where limited formability is acceptable but usage is not limited to such applications. Certain design and processing procedures may cause these products to become susceptible to stress-corrosion cracking; SAE ARP 823 recommends practices to minimize such conditions.
